Nurse accountability, which involves the delivery and accurate documentation of quality care, is vital. Healthcare facilities and agencies have contiguous (or continuous) quality improvement committees. What is the role of this committee?
 
  A) Monitors quality of ongoing care
  B) Caters to employees who are unable to work
  C) Assigns recognition to hospitals
  D) Offers health services.

Answer to Question 1

A
Feedback:
Continuous quality improvement committees monitor quality of ongoing care. Joint Commission assigns recognition to hospitals. Social Security Disability insurance caters to employees who are unable to work and health maintenance organizations offer health services.
